In this episode, Briana and Dr. Collins begin the discussion with the recent disaster happening on our east coast following Hurricane Helene. Dr. Collins shares his thoughts on what it was like in the South following Hurricane Katrina, and Briana shares about how Airbnb has began efforts to support people who may be displaced. The rest of the discussion includes fall-themed events, Hispanic Hertiage Month, health and fasting for women, along with what new things are going following Tim Kelly's State of the City address and the city's new branding.
